A Practical Gram-Scale Synthesis of Acrylohydroxamic Acid
Synthesis ( IF 2.6 ) Pub Date : 2017-08-30 , DOI: 10.1055/s-0036-1589103
Bruce Hamper 1 , Brendan Sullivan 1 , Nigam Rath 2 , Christopher Spilling 1
Affiliation  

Abstract

Acrylohydroxamic acid, which is a useful monomer for the preparation of polymeric materials, has been prepared in a straightforward, two-step synthesis from readily available starting materials. The key steps are coupling of acrylic acid with O-tetrahydropyranylhydroxyl amine to provide protection of the hydroxylamine functionality, followed by acid cleavage of the protecting group.
